What is stracciatella?

The stracciatella we are talking about on this page is stracciatella ice cream. The ice cream flavor is also what most people associate with the term stracciatella, in Italy as well.

In Italy though there are two other things we call stracciatella, and they have nothing to do with ice cream: stracciatella is also a type of soup from central Italy; and stracciatella di bufala, a type of cheese made with buffalo milk.

As we will see, the ice cream flavor is so named because the process by which it is made is reminiscent of the preparation of the stracciatella soup.

The origin of stracciatella ice cream flavor

Where does stracciatella ice cream come from? Seems like a misguided question for an ice cream flavour. But for the stracciatella we know when and where it originated. The credit goes to Enrico Panattoni, ice cream seller from Bergamo, in the café La Marianna, who gave the name stracciatella to his gelato in 1961.

Stracciatella ice cream is based on fiordilatte, which is the Italian milk ice cream flavor with whipping cream and without egg, the basis of many other ice cream flavors such as chocolate ice cream, frozen yogurt or pistachio ice cream.

Café La Marianna was renowned precisely for the ice cream flavor invented by Enrico Panattoni.
In 1961 Enrico did an experiment: while the ice cream was being mixed by the ice cream maker, just before it was ready, he combined hot chocolate flakes with the ice cream. In contact with the cold mixture, the chocolate chips solidify and create the hue of the stracciatella.


The ice cream of the city of Bergamo

Today, the city of Bergamo appreciates the origin of the stracciatella gelato: the ice cream parlors of the city have produced a certificate of originality of the stracciatella ice cream, with guidelines for its production. The ingredients of the stracciatella are sugar, whipping cream and whole milk; plus the chocolate flakes, which must contain at least 58% cocoa. The original stracciatella ice cream recipe from Bergamo does not contain eggs.


The name Stracciatella

The name of the stracciatella ice cream comes from the stracciatella uit Rome: a soup prepared in Lazio, Abruzzo, Marche and Tuscany regions, where the beaten egg is poured into the boiling broth. The preparation of this soup reminded Panattoni of his ice cream, hence the name.

👉 In the culinary field, the Italian word stracciato refers to the combination of ingredients at different temperatures.

The stracciatella ice cream recipe is the same as the milk ice cream recipe: the only difference is the addition of chocolate flakes, when the ice cream is almost ready.

👉 Do you want to make stracciatella ice cream with eggs? You can follow the crema ice cream recipe with eggs and add the chocolate chips at the end. The preparation does not change. With the addition of eggs, the ice cream becomes slightly creamier.

In Italian we call Stracciatella ice cream with eggs with the funny name 🔊 Stracciacrema.


What's in stracciatella ice cream?

Often, online recipes make stracciatella ice cream with eggs, which are not part of the Italian recipe for stracciatella.

To obtain a creamy Stracciatella gelato, use fresh whole milk 3.5% fat; and whipping cream with 35% fat.
You don't need to whip the cream before adding it to the mixture!

Which chocolate for stracciatella ice cream?

The chocolate you like best, of course. The original stracciatella ice cream recipe contains pure chocolate, but milk chocolate is also fine. If you are creative you can also experiment with a mix of different types of chocolate.

To cut chocolate into flakes, you can use a knife, or a grater such as those used for cutting vegetables.

The chocolate flakes should not be too large so that they do not interfere with the rotation of the mixing paddle in the ice cream maker.

Instructions

For this recipe we use one of the most popular models of compressor ice cream maker; the steps of the procedure are the same for practically all the ice cream machines on the market.

  1. Turn on the ice cream maker

    Turn on the ice cream maker: it will take a few minutes for it to reach the right temperature to make the ice cream. More or less the time it takes to mix the ingredients.


  2. Mix the ingredients

    Pour the whipping cream, whole milk and sugar into a bowl: first the liquids and then the powders.

    Mix the ingredients with an immersion mixer. Mix them on low speed until you get a hom*ogeneous mixture.

    No immersion mixer? A blender is also fine, of course. Use it on low speed for 1-2 minutes to get a smooth mixture.

  3. Pour the mixture into the ice cream maker

    Pour the mixture into the ice cream maker and make sure that:

    • the ice machine is already cold.

      Some ice machines display the temperature: to make ice the ice machine must be at least -7.6°F (-22°C).

    • The mixing paddle is already rotating.

    👉 These tricks are the secret of using the ice cream maker. If the ice cream remains liquid, or the ice cream maker gets stuck before the ice cream is ready, it is usually because of this step.


  4. Let it mix for 30 minutes

    Usually the ice cream maker takes a little more than 30 minutes to make ice cream: it depends on the ice cream maker, the amount of ice cream and the ingredients.

    To make stracciatella ice cream, add the chocolate flakes when the ice cream is almost ready.

    👉 We advise you to check the ice cream after 20 minutes by looking through the transparent lid of the ice cream maker.

    When the ice cream begins to set and to look like a gelato, it is time to pour in the chocolate flakes.


  5. Pour the chocolate chips

    Is the ice cream almost ready? Pour in the chocolate pieces and let the ice cream maker mix for another 4-5 minutes.

    The ice cream is ready when the mixing paddle stops or the ice maker timer runs out.

    With a little experience, you can easily understand just the right time to get the ice out of your ice cream maker.

What's the difference between gelato and ice cream? ›

Like ice cream, gelato uses milk, cream, and sugar, but it differs in proportions. Gelato uses less cream and more milk than ice cream and typically contains no egg yolks or eggs at all. Gelato is served slightly warmer than American ice cream and is also churned at a slower rate, introducing less air into the product.

Is stracciatella similar to mozzarella? ›

Stracciatella is a version of fresh mozzarella that's been torn into fine shreds as part of the stretching process. The word means "little rag" in Italian, referencing the look of the torn cheese. It was developed in the 1920s in Andria, a commune in Puglia in southern Italy.
